What is Fire Glass?

Fire glass is a type of tempered glass created specifically for gas fire pits and fireplaces to use in place of gas logs. This glass is created to withstand high temperatures and will not melt, burn or discolor.

You can purchase fire glass in various colors, types, and sizes to fit your fire glass style preference. Not only does fire glass bring a unique vibrant appearance to your gas fire pits, but also brings with it several advantages in comparison to gas logs in natural gas or propane fire pits.

How To Calculate How Many LBS Of Fire Glass You Need:

1. measure the width across the center of the fire pit (in inches)
2. multiply the result times the depth from the front to the back
3. divide the result by 20.5
4. multiply the result by the number of inches high you would like the glass (which should be at least enough to cover the top of your burner.)

For Fire Pits:
1. Divide the diameter (inches) by 2
2. Square the result
3. Multiply the result by 0.15
4. Multiply the result by the number of inches deep
